XES Synergix 8825/8830/8850/8855 & X2-TECH System Introduction Appendix 2 (continued) Controller Firmware • Convenient administration of printer operating settings from individual workstations using the Web PMT. • Print queue can be viewed and managed (with the appropriate password) at individual workstations using the Web PMT or Printer Queue in the AccXES Client Tools. • Media Mismatch queuing routes any page of a job for which the proper paper type or size is not loaded to a separate queue. Other pages or jobs compatible with the loaded paper type or size continue to print. • Bi-directional capabilities of the Windows RTL/GL2 Print Drivers communicate with the Controller to determine the feature set to display. • A Net Port Monitor, available for installation with the RTL/GL2 Drivers, provides a reliable port for TCP/IP network printing. • Job Accounting enables the recording of copying, scanning, and printing activities. • Plot Nesting allows the most advantageous use of media by arranging single or multiple page jobs on the output media to minimize waste. • Scanning to the network, which is a standard feature of the XES Synergix 8855 Digital Solution, provides a convenient way to retrieve scanned documents at the local workstation in TIFF, CALS, and PDF formats. • Effective with Firmware Release 7.5, a new Color Enablement feature key is available enabling Scanning-to-Net in color in TIFF and JPEG formats. The printing of JPEG files is also enabled in Firmware Release 7.5. 62 Synergix Scan System • Documents can be scanned to be printed or retrieved through the network. • Media options (e.g., media location, media type, image quality) and output format are selected through menu choices or buttons on the user interface. • Job accounting can be used to record copying and scanning activities. • 4 ips scanning speed is standard. Web Print Manager Tool • This tool is used to change printer default settings, (such as adding labels or stamps, using plot nesting, page composition, rotation, or scale to fit features). This tool is also used to view the status or change the priority of print jobs in the print queue. • The Web PMT is accessed from your workstation using the Netscape 4.0 (or newer) or Internet Explorer 4.0 (or newer) web browser. It is part of the AccXES Controller software.
